FOO FIGHTERS’ TAYLOR HAWKINS ANNOUNCES NEW SOLO ALBUM, PREMIERES FIRST SINGLE
by Matt Bishop | November 1, 2016 Foo Fighters drummer Taylor Hawkins is continuing his productivity during the band’s hiatus. In addition to touring with his cover band Chevy Metal, Hawkins has announced that he will release a solo album on November 11.
